Nginx、Tengine、OpenRestry的http和tcp后端健康检查【20260520-005篇】
文章目录✅ 一、核心能力概览(按产品维度)✅ 二、HTTP 健康检查配置示例(三者对比)▪️ Nginx(被动式,基础可靠)▪️ Tengine(主动式,开箱即用)▪️ OpenResty(Lua 主动式,高度可控)✅ 三、TCP 健康检查配置示例▪️ Tengine(最简洁)▪️ OpenResty(TCP + 协议层校验)▪️ Nginx(仅 stream 模块 + 被动 fallback)✅ 四、关键参数对比表(健康检查核心字段)✅ 五、选型建议(2026 年实战视角)根据您提供的文档与网络搜索数据,以下是对Nginx、Tengine、OpenResty在HTTP 和 TCP 后端服务健康检查方面的全面对比与配置说明(截至2026-05-20,信息综合自官方文档、Tengine 官方资料及主流实践):✅ 一、核心能力概览(按产品维度)特性Nginx(原生开源版)Tengine(淘宝增强版)OpenResty(Lua 驱动平台)HTTP 健康检查❌ 不支持主动检查;仅被动探测(依赖proxy_next_upstream+max_fails/fail_timeout)✅ 原生内置ngx_http_upstream_check_module,支持 HTTP/TCP/SSL/MySQL/AJP 等多协议主动探活⚠️ 默认不带;需手动编译集成nginx_upstream_check_module(社区常用),或用 Lua 自实现(灵活但复杂)TCP
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2627788.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!